Default Bodog 100k Pre-flop with 88....

Bodog 100k tournament. Blinds are at 100/200, I'm in the BB with a 3.2k stack and 88. 270 left, top 81 get paid. My stack is right around average. Dan Druff (uber seat cover spinner) opens in MP for 600 with about 1.3k behind. It folds to me...

Push, fold, call or Stop and go and why?
